public class RandomAccessSDFReader extends RandomAccessReader
Constructor and Description |
---|
RandomAccessSDFReader(File file,
IChemObjectBuilder builder) |
RandomAccessSDFReader(File file,
IChemObjectBuilder builder,
IReaderListener listener) |
Modifier and Type | Method and Description |
---|---|
boolean |
accepts(Class classObject) |
ISimpleChemObjectReader |
createChemObjectReader() |
IResourceFormat |
getFormat() |
void |
remove() |
void |
setReader(InputStream reader) |
void |
setReader(Reader reader) |
add, addChemObjectIOListener, close, first, getChemObjectReader, getCurrentRecord, getIndexFile, hasNext, hasPrevious, isIndexCreated, last, next, nextIndex, previous, previousIndex, readRecord, removeChemObjectIOListener, set, setChemObjectReader, setIndexCreated, size, toString
getIOSettings, setReaderMode
public RandomAccessSDFReader(File file, IChemObjectBuilder builder) throws IOException
file
- builder
- IOException
public RandomAccessSDFReader(File file, IChemObjectBuilder builder, IReaderListener listener) throws IOException
IOException
public ISimpleChemObjectReader createChemObjectReader()
createChemObjectReader
in class RandomAccessReader
@TestMethod(value="testGetFormat") public IResourceFormat getFormat()
@TestMethod(value="testSetReader_Reader") public void setReader(Reader reader) throws CDKException
CDKException
@TestMethod(value="testSetReader_InputStream") public void setReader(InputStream reader) throws CDKException
CDKException
@TestMethod(value="testAccepts") public boolean accepts(Class classObject)
public void remove()